Aliasy, vytvorte dočasné alebo trvalé aliasy pre najpoužívanejšie príkazy

o alias

V nasledujúcom článku sa pozrieme na aliasový nástroj. Používatelia GNU / Linuxu to často potrebujú používajte stále ten istý príkaz. Toľkokrát zadaný alebo kopírovaný príkaz môže znížiť produktivitu a odvrátiť pozornosť od toho, čo skutočne robíte.

Môžeme si ušetriť nejaký čas vytváranie aliasov pre naše najpoužívanejšie príkazy. Sú to niečo ako vlastné skratky. Používa sa na predstavenie príkazu (alebo skupiny príkazov) vykonaného s alebo bez vlastných možností.

Niektorí neodporúčajú používať takéto nástroje, pretože napriek svojej veľkej užitočnosti jeho použitie môže byť kontraproduktívne. Najmä pre používateľov, ktorí začínajú vo svete Gnu / Linux a jeho termináli. Pretože aj keď môže byť použitie vlastných príkazov veľmi užitočné a priateľské, môže nás tiež zabudnúť na skutočné príkazy.

Zoznam aliasov na vašom Ubuntu

Tento nástroj je už predvolene nainštalovaný v našom Ubuntu. Aby sme ho mohli použiť, budeme musieť iba upraviť súbor .bashrc to je v Osobnom priečinku, skrytým spôsobom.

Najskôr budeme môcť vidieť a zoznam definovaný v našom profile práve spustením tohto príkazu v termináli (Ctrl + Alt + T):

alias

príkazový alias predvolený ubuntu

Tu môžete vidieť Užívateľom definované predvolené aliasy v Ubuntu 18.04. Ako je uvedené na snímke obrazovky, vykonaním v termináli (Ctrl + Alt + T) príkaz «la»Bolo by to ekvivalent behu:

ls -A

Budeme schopní vytvoriť jeden z týchto odkazov s jedným znakom. Bude to ekvivalent príkazu podľa nášho výberu.

Ako vytvárať aliasy

Ich tvorba je pomerne rýchly a ľahký proces. Tvoriť môže ktokoľvek niektoré z týchto dvoch typov: dočasné a trvalé.

Vytvorte dočasné aliasy

Musíme do terminálu napísať slovo alias. Potom budeme musieť použiť meno, ktoré chceme použiť na vykonanie príkazu. Potom bude nasledovať znamienko '=' a volanie príkazu, ktorý chceme použiť.

Nasledujúca syntax je:

alias nombreAlias="tu comando personalizado aquí"

Toto by bol skutočný príklad:

alias htdocs=”cd /opt/lampp/htdocs”

dočasný alias v ubuntu

Po definovaní budeme môcť pomocou skratky 'htdocs' prejsť do adresára htdocs. Problém s touto skratkou je v tom bude k dispozícii iba pre vašu aktuálnu reláciu terminálu. Ak otvoríte novú reláciu terminálu, alias už nebude k dispozícii. Ak ich chcete uložiť medzi reláciami, budete potrebovať trvalé.

Vytvorte trvalé aliasy

Ak chcete zachovať aliasy medzi reláciami, budete ich musieť uložiť do priečinka profilový súbor pre konfiguráciu shellu vášho používateľa. Môžu to byť:

  • údery → ~ / .bashrc
  • Z SH → ~ / .zshrc
  • Ryby → ~ / .Config / ryby / config.fish

Syntax, ktorá sa má v tomto prípade použiť, je rovnaká ako pri vytváraní dočasnej. Rozdiel je iba v tom, že ho tentokrát uložíme do súboru. Napríklad v bashe môžete otvoriť súbor .bashrc pomocou svojho obľúbeného editora:

vim ~/.bashrc

V súbore vyhľadajte v súbore miesto na uloženie aliasov. Dobré miesto na ich pridanie je zvyčajne na konci súboru. Z organizačných dôvodov môžete zanechať komentár pred:

vytvoriť trvalé aliasy

#Mis alias personalizados
alias imagenes=”cd /home/sapoclay/Imágenes/”
alias actualizarsistema=”sudo apt update && sudo apt upgrade”
alias pingxbmc="ping 192.168.1.100"

Po dokončení súbor uložte. Tento súbor sa automaticky nahrá pri nasledujúcej relácii. Ak chcete použiť to, čo ste práve napísali v aktuálnej relácii, spustite nasledujúci príkaz:

source ~/.bashrc

Budeme tiež schopní mať naše aliasy v samostatnom dokumente. Ak chcete definovať trvalý alias, musíte postupovať podľa pokynov, ktoré nám ukazuje súbor bashrc. Budeme môcť mať samostatný súbor s názvom bash_aliases na ich uloženie.

podať výzvu na prezývku

Každý, koho v tomto súbore vytvoríme, bude pracovať pri ďalšom otvorení nového terminálu. Na okamžité použitie zmien môžeme použiť nasledujúci príkaz:

súbor bash_aliases

source ~/.bash_aliases

Odstrániť aliasy

pomôcť unalias

na sk Odstrániť alias pridaný pomocou príkazového riadku, môžete použiť príkaz unalias.

unalias nombre_del_alias

V prípade chcenia odstrániť všetky definície aliasov, môžeme vykonať nasledujúci príkaz:

unalias -a [elimina todos los alias]

Musíte to mať na pamäti príkaz unalias sa vzťahuje iba na aktuálnu reláciu. Ak chcete jednu natrvalo odstrániť, musíme odstrániť príslušnú položku v súbore ~ ​​/ .bash_aliases.

Ďalšia vec, ktorú treba mať na pamäti, je, že ak máme permanentný alias a pridáme dočasný počas relácie s rovnakým menom, dočasný bude mať počas aktuálnej relácie vyššie oprávnenia.

Toto bol malý sprievodný príklad toho, ako si vytvoriť vlastné aliasy na vykonávanie často používaných príkazov. Pre dozvedieť sa viac o tomto nástroji, môžete si prečítať článok napísaný v Wikipedia.


Zanechajte svoj komentár

Vaša e-mailová adresa nebude zverejnená. Povinné položky sú označené *

*

*

  1. Zodpovedný za údaje: Miguel Ángel Gatón
  2. Účel údajov: Kontrolný SPAM, správa komentárov.
  3. Legitimácia: Váš súhlas
  4. Oznamovanie údajov: Údaje nebudú poskytnuté tretím stranám, iba ak to vyplýva zo zákona.
  5. Ukladanie dát: Databáza hostená spoločnosťou Occentus Networks (EU)
  6. Práva: Svoje údaje môžete kedykoľvek obmedziť, obnoviť a vymazať.

  1.   Proste chlap dijo

    Úžasné, miloval som to !!! slúžil mi perfektne.